How translators rendered it

Translation · 4 editions

These translations render verse 25:42 — the whole verse this word appears in — not this word alone. The correspondence is verse-level: no word-level alignment of translations exists for these editions, so we do not claim which English word renders this Arabic word. Compare the editions →

“He nearly led us away from our gods, had we not patiently adhered to them.” But they will know, when they witness the torment, who is further away from the way
Translation · Talal Itani (2012)CC BY-NC-ND 4.0
He would have led us far away from our gods if we had not been staunch to them. They will know, when they behold the doom, who is more astray as to the road
Translation · Marmaduke Pickthall (1930)Public Domain
Indeed he had well nigh led us astray from our gods, had we not persevered steadfastly in their service." But in the end they shall know, when they shall see the punishment, who hath most strayed from the path
Translation · John Medows Rodwell (1861)Public Domain
he well-nigh leads us astray from our gods, had we not been patient about them.' But they shall know, when they see the torment, who errs most from the path
Translation · Edward Henry Palmer (1880)Public Domain
